Filipino Forensic Genealogist
Brett Holbert Roño LasayBrett is a full-time professional genealogist offering forensic genealogy and traditional family history research services. He obtained his professional certificate in family history research from Brigham Young University-Idaho. He is a member of the Association of Professional Genealogists (APG).
He has more than 4000 hours of professional genealogy research work experience. His work experience include: Filipino family history research; African-American research, heir search for probate, mortgage foreclosures, and real estate in the United States; military repatriation; and Spanish citizenship by descent applications. His research countries are mainly the Philippines and the United States. His casework has involved international research including in Spain, Canada, France, Germany, United Kingdom, Mexico, and Puerto Rico.
Brett is a regular FamilySearch center volunteer and has spoken to and trained others about family history research in the Philippines.
